"Discover the Kirks Dik-Dik: A Fascinating African Antelope" The Kirks dik-dik (Madoqua kirkii) is a small antelope species found in various regions of Africa, including Tanzania's Tarangire National Park. With its petite size and distinctive appearance, this creature never fails to captivate wildlife enthusiasts. In Tarangire National Park, you may come across a male Kirks dik-dik gracefully roaming the savannah. Its slender body and elegant horns make it a true symbol of beauty in the wild. Meanwhile, females can also be spotted nearby, blending seamlessly into their surroundings as they forage for food.
